On April 1st, Prime Minister Narendra Modi extended his warm wishes to the people of Odisha on the occasion of Utkal Divas. The day marks the formation of Odisha as a separate province in 1936, and it is celebrated every year by the people of the state. Prime Minister Modi took to social media to share his greetings with the people of Odisha and appreciated the state’s rich cultural heritage and its contributions to the development of India.

Odisha’s Cultural Heritage and Identity
Utkal Divas is not only a commemoration of the formation of the state but also a celebration of Odisha’s diverse culture. The people of Odisha are known for their pride in their heritage, and the day is a reminder of their continued journey towards progress. The state is home to iconic landmarks like the Konark Sun Temple and the Jagannath Temple, as well as unique cultural traditions such as Odissi dance and the Rath Yatra.
Chief Minister Mohan Charn Majhi extends greetings on Utkal Divas
On this occasion, Chief Minister Mohan Charn Majhi extended his greetings and stated that this is a day to pay tribute to the great individuals who sacrificed for the formation of Odisha.
The CM wrote on his X handle in Odia, “On the occasion of Odisha Day, I extend my heartfelt congratulations and best wishes to all. I pay my humble tribute to the great souls who made immense sacrifices for the creation of the separate Odisha state and for enhancing the glory of our language, literature, and culture. On this day, let us further strengthen our resolve to build a healthy and developed Odisha.”
Various Programs Organized Across the State
In celebration of this historic occasion, several programs are being organized across the state.
Earlier, the state’s Culture Minister, Suryavanshi Suraj, announced that for the first time, the ‘Odia Week’ will be celebrated with great enthusiasm from April 1 to April 14, coinciding with the Odia New Year. Various government departments will host activities from block-level to state-level, including cleanliness drives at historical sites, distribution of Odia language learning materials, blood donation camps, “Buy Odia Books” campaigns, folk art festivals, and Youth Writer’s Day.
